Early signs are vague: fatigue, irritability. Severe deficiency (beriberi) involves nerve pain, muscle weakness, and confusion. See a doctor; don't self-diagnose.
Yes. It's the standard, stable, well-studied form. Don't fall for marketing on exotic, expensive versions unless your doctor specifies one.
Yes, but check the label first. Your multi likely already provides 100% or more of the daily recommended B1, making an extra supplement redundant.

Found widely in nature. Rich sources include whole grains, legumes, nuts, and meat, especially pork.
